The autofocus system responds instantly.
The new AF system incorporated
in the EOS-1 has been improved to
meet the high standards of profes
sional photographers. It’s faster. It
works better under low-light condi
tions. And it’s more precise.
There are three focusing modes:
1. One-shot AF mode. AF
operation is completed and locked
once in-focus is achieved. When
shooting in this mode, the shutter
will not release until AF is com
pleted. With evaluative metering, AF
lock and AE lock occur simultane
ously. Metering continues until just
before the exposure is made when
using spot metering or partial
metering.
2. Predictive AI servo AF mode.
This sophisticated mode enables
focus prediction control for moving
subjects. This involves shutter-
release priority, and during con
tinuous shooting, the lens is adjusted
for the movement of the subject.
Custom Function No. 4 even allows
for convenient AF lock in servo
mode.
3.
Manual mode. A switch on the
lens barrel permits the change from
AF to manual operation. The green
LED indicator in the viewfinder still
lights up to indicate that the subject
is in focus.
The AF system on the EOS-1
focuses even faster than the system
used on the EOS 630. This higher
speed enables AI servo AF shooting
at up to 4.5 frames per second when
using the Power Drive Booster El
plus an ultrasonic motor lens or one
of the newly-developed professional
L series lenses. It’s quick enough to
catch each segment of fast-breaking
action.
